Hajoca Corporation is one of the country's largest privately-held wholesale distributors of plumbing, heating & cooling, and industrial supplies. Founded in 1858, Hajoca is a company based on the principles of "Service, Integrity, Reliability," and on relationships of trust and support with teammates, customers, and suppliers. Throughout its history, Hajoca has played an active role in shaping advances in plumbing. However, we attribute our success to two simple truths; a unique business philosophy and talented people. Hajoca is all about the people, who give us our advantage, and who will guide us successfully into the future.
Although Hajoca is a large company, we work in a decentralized environment where each of our locations, called Profit Centers (PCs), is run by the Profit Center Manager as if it were their own small business. A typical Profit Center is the heart of our business and consists of a warehouse, counter, sales office, and (sometimes) a showroom. Our PCs conduct business under unique trade names and offer a customized business approach, honoring what's special about each local marketplace.

About the Role:
You will:
  • Supervise, schedule and train warehouse and delivery staff to ensure safe and efficient operation of all warehouse functions.
  • Ensure that merchandise is received and stored in an efficient and economical manner and maintain required records in conformance with company policy.
  • Supervise the proper routing, loading, and preparation of orders for shipment and delivery in accordance with customer instructions.
  • Review and maintain appropriate DOT records and physical examination certificates for drivers, ensure current training certification for forklift/material handling equipment operators.

  • Supervise and schedule the maintenance of all company delivery vehicles and material handling equipment in use in the warehouse.
  • Recommend purchases of warehouse equipment; keep abreast of new warehousing methods.
  • Maintain the safety of warehouse operations in compliance with the company's Safety Standards, OSHA and any other applicable regulations.
  • Maintain the security of warehouse and grounds to protect the Profit Center's assets.
  • Resolve all delivery complaints and receiving disputes quickly and effectively.

  • Perform all job functions in accordance with the company's Safety Standards.
  • Successfully complete required safety and compliance training programs as assigned.
  • Perform other reasonably related duties as assigned by immediate supervisor and other management as required.
